Where can I get information about adding a jumpseat to my second row of captains chairs?

Need to seat 8 instead of 7... 2001 Suburban 2500 with grey leather buckets, and I'd be interested to install a jumpseat or replace entirely with a bench. Every time I google, it leads me to these forums but I'm not sure where to start on my own search!

I actually did this when we had our sixth child. I bought a middle row bench which matched the year, model, and interior according to my vin and yes, all the holes are for installing are already in the chassis under the carpet. My Chevy dealer would not install it but a custom car shop happily did.
